The Rise of Open-Source Models and the Changing Landscape of AI

Introduction:
In recent years, open-source models have gained significant traction in the field of artificial intelligence. The idea that free, unrestricted alternatives can rival and even outperform proprietary models is challenging the traditional notion of value in the AI landscape. This article explores the benefits of open-source models, the importance of rapid iteration, the role of personalized language models, and the implications for industry giants like Google and OpenAI.

  1. The Power of Open-Source Models:
    Open-source models offer several advantages over restricted models. They are faster, more customizable, and maintain privacy better. When the quality of free alternatives matches that of proprietary models, people are less likely to pay for restricted access. This shift challenges the notion of a competitive advantage based solely on proprietary technology.

  2. The Importance of Rapid Iteration:
    In the pursuit of the best models, speed is crucial. The ability to iterate quickly allows for continuous improvement and adaptation to changing requirements. Small variants of models should be given more attention rather than being treated as an afterthought. The breakthroughs achieved in models with fewer than 20 billion parameters have shown the potential for innovation and the need to focus on scalability.

  3. Personalized Language Models:
    The advent of low-rank factorizations, such as LoRA, has revolutionized model fine-tuning. These factorizations significantly reduce the size of update matrices, enabling efficient personalization of language models. The ability to incorporate new knowledge in near real-time, within a few hours and using consumer hardware, has tremendous implications for various applications.

  4. Leveraging Model Distillation:
    In cases where major architectural improvements prevent the direct reuse of model weights, aggressive forms of distillation can be employed. This approach allows the retention of previous generation capabilities while still benefiting from advancements. The low cost associated with LoRA updates makes them accessible to anyone with an idea, fostering a culture of innovation and democratizing the AI landscape.

  5. The Flexibility of Data Scaling Laws:
    Highly curated datasets have proven to be valuable in training models effectively. This suggests that there is flexibility in data scaling laws. Open-source projects and research institutions worldwide are leveraging this concept, surpassing the limitations of large-scale proprietary datasets. The ability to tap into diverse and curated data sources is becoming the standard for training outside of Google.

  6. Meta: The Ecosystem Winner:
    Meta, the company behind the leaked model, has inadvertently gained an advantage by receiving a vast amount of free labor. As open-source innovation predominantly occurs on top of their architecture, they can seamlessly incorporate these advancements into their products. This strategy aligns with Google's success in owning platforms like Chrome and Android, solidifying their position as thought leaders and shaping the narrative of larger ideas.

Conclusion:
The rise of open-source models is reshaping the AI landscape, challenging established players like Google and OpenAI. The ability to access innovative models, iterate rapidly, and leverage highly curated datasets has put the power of AI in the hands of individual developers and researchers. To stay ahead, companies must embrace open-source models, foster innovation, and invest in platforms that allow them to shape the narrative of AI advancement.
